WebCan ideal gases exist? While no ideal gases exist, many gases behave like ideal gases under certain conditions. The concept of an ideal gas is useful for understanding gas behavior and simplifying the calculation of gas properties. An ideal gas is just a theoretical gas composed of several randomly-moving and non-interacting particles. It does not exist in nature. However, real gases can behave as ideal gases under certain specific conditions when the intermolecular forces become negligible.

This equation yields the ideal gas equations upon setting a=0 and b=0. It can be proven that for a situation where the molar volume (volume occupied by 1 mol of substance) is much larger than a and b, they can be effectively considered as zero. So, we can use the ideal gas law.
